    Description

    Job Summary

    As a Mobile Phlebotomist at Aculabs, you will be responsible for traveling to various locations to collect blood samples from patients. Your primary focus will be on providing efficient and compassionate phlebotomy services while ensuring accuracy and patient comfort.

    About the Company

    Aculabs, a leading provider of laboratory services to long-term care facilities throughout the Mid-Atlantic, is looking for Phlebotomists to join our mobile team. Aculabs has been proudly family-owned and operated since 1972. Ideal candidates are motivated self-starters eager to learn and train alongside an experienced team member.     Responsibilities

    • Travel to different locations to collect blood samples
    • Follow established procedures for sample collection and handling
    • Interact with patients professionally and provide necessary information
    • Maintain proper documentation of samples collected
    • Adhere to safety and infection control policies

    Requirements

    • Phlebotomy certification and experience (Minimum 1 year is required)
    •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
    • Ability to work independently and manage time efficiently
    • Valid driver's license and reliable vehicle
    • Personal Mobile Phone
